Output 725e85ee391b710ecdf9f9e55e7e37347768987943389710e8bf4d2245a8bbba:20

value
21126412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 428a869a8559c04dbe06f6c891f17e8e74086230 OP_EQUALVERIFY OP_CHECKSIG
address
174qYbuTkrsAwhusDPsHYhUtefzvp5D6sh
transaction
725e85ee391b710ecdf9f9e55e7e37347768987943389710e8bf4d2245a8bbba
spent
true